If you dig into the rules there’s more to it than that. It’s a flier with zoom and supersonic, so it has a 4+ jink the turn it lands. If the CSM version chooses which mode it lands in (the 30k one deploys in hover mode) then it’s 6s to hit and a 4+ jink on an AV12 3HP flier on turn 1 anywhere on the board. That’s way better than a drop pod for an assault squad and the internal guidance doesn’t matter (since you’re a skimmer that can move after deepstriking in). The heat blast weapons are all hot garbage. The thing that limits it, in my mind, is how far you can move before you disembark troops. Is it just 6 inches? If yes, that means you’re forced to drop ~24” away from your target, move within 6”, take a turn of shooting, and then turn 2 move 6”, disembark 3”, and then assault hopefully 6". If it’s more than 6” movement before being able to disembark? Then it’s a lot better.

It doesn't have Supersonic, although as a flyer it can still move in Zoom mode if it wants to (except for the turn it arrives, when it is forced to Hover.) 4+ Jink is obviously still some protection, but it's not great, especially in the current environment. And yeah, you can only move 6" before the guys inside get out. However, as was pointed out to me, when in Hover mode it counts as a Fast Skimmer and can thus Flat Out 18", giving it a reasonable ability to get to where it needs to be. I still really don't like the 100pt price tag, tho.

Sounds like the rules are the same as in the legion books. It would be great at <75 points, I agree, but at 100 its still a turn 2 assault delivery vehicle. The other options are 150-300 points each, and come in the form of Angry Tractor, Crastus, or Spartan. They are better, but slower and cost more points. With those you're looking at a turn 3-4 charge if they survive. The other option is buying 100 points of additional bodies and foot slogging it across the board. That comes out to be an extra 10 tactical or 6 assault marines. The former are slow as gently caress and the latter are espensive as gently caress. So, all in all, I think its pretty decent for the price and where it sits compared to the others. It could be better, but for an assault army its basically a 100 point tax that gets you AV12, 3HP, and 4++ before you charge your guys in. ... or you could just get bikes.
